San Ramon Valley schools named top in the state Schools & Kids, posted by Editor, Danville Weekly Online, on May 10, 2012 at 6:05 am
The U.S. News and World Report recently released its [Web Link list of top high schools] in the nation. All San Ramon Valley Unified schools cracked the 200 mark in state rankings.
